College and university courses to be conducted online until end of year: MOHE

KUCHING, May 28: All teaching and learning (PdP) activities in colleges and universities are to be conducted online and face-to-face lessons are not allowed until Dec 31, 2020.

Ministry of Higher Education (MOHE), in a statement yesterday (May 27), however said that exceptions are given to five categories of students to return to campuses in stages.

In the first category, postgraduate research students in private and public institutions of higher learning are allowed back on campus immediately but only for those who are required to attend physical laboratories, workshop, design studio or use specialised equipment to complete their research.


Students in the other four categories will have to wait until the Conditional Movement Control Order (CMCO) is lifted.

“Final year and semester certificate, diploma and degree students who need to complete clinical works, practicals, lab works, workshops, work in design studios, or are in need of specialised equipment, are allowed to carry out PdP activities on campus as early as July 1.

“Students in final year/semester who do not have access to learning needs and are in unconducive environments for PdP online, are allowed to return to campus and utilise infrastructure for online lessons as early as July 1,” MOHE explained.

For students with special needs under Technical and Vocational Training (TVET) education programme at polytechnics and community colleges, who require face-to-face guidance for PdP due to learning difficulties, MOHE informed that they would be allowed as early as Aug 1.

MOHE also listed the dates for new students in the 2020/2021 academic sessions at all public and private higher learning institutions including polytechnics and community colleges for certificate, foundation and diploma courses for SPM leavers, as well as for Bachelor’s Degree programme intake for Sijil Tinggi Pelajaran Malaysia (STPM) leavers and its equivalent.

“Admission for certificate and diploma students in polytechnics and community colleges, as early as July 1.

“Admission for foundation, certificate, diploma and Bachelor’s Degree students at private institutes of higher learning as early as July 1.

“Admission for foundation and diploma students in public universities, as early as Aug 1.

“Admission for undergraduate and postgraduate students for the research mode at public and private universities as early as Oct 1.”

MOHE also urged that academic activities on campuses be conducted according to the standard operating procedure (SOP) and to strictly follow all safety and health guideline as well as social distancing rule.—DayakDaily
